For non Caesar havers, esp if you're running Koleda or not have a lot of crit rolls you can sub Ben - his passive gives an extra 16% crit when S11 has his shield on, also + 28% on Inferno metal gives a staggering free 46% crit. Plus Ben can work with scuffed discs as long as the mains are def on Discs 4 - 6, or impact on D6 if you don't have available stunners left. Her F2P team would be S12, Ben, Lucy
S11 was my first S-Rank, pulled her _real_ early, so I've had her as a primary attacker basically my whole playthrough. One thing this gets wrong: Don't sleep on the EX Special invulnerability. Timed correctly, you can use it to dodge some pretty nasty attacks and maintain uptime on her offense. Also, her dodge counters trigger a few hits of guaranteed Fire Suppression, so you (again) don't lose uptime. S11 is odd, she's got a high skill ceiling, but it's all execution, not tactics. You don't need any funky setup or special comp to break faces with her. My usual team is Soldier11, Caesar, and either Nicole or Burnice. Nicole for her chain attack to soften up targets, or Burnice as a burst off-DPS. Ceasar of course, provides her barrier and I've got her set up for slugfests as well.
